    Just getting to spend some time under the stars with old friends again. Every single Star Wars movie is dear to me because of the different points of life they came at me and how I felt seeing them in the theater for the first time.

    The biggest thing I like about the existence of the ST however is that I will get to take my son to see them, and he will be the same age I was (5 years old) the first time I saw that yellow scroll over the star field. That is going to be so cool. I already have plans to get him out of school that day to take him to a matinee on opening day. I'll probably watch him more than the movie so I will be sure to see it at midnight the day before!
